CDFIs provide financial services, education and loans to support economic growth and development for families and small businesses. Many qualify, but are unable to secure needed funding through mainstream, traditional financial sources. The work of CDFIs enriches our communities and the quality of life for residents.

-Sheilah Clay, Purposeful Consulting, LLC, Farmington Hills, MI
